Pimpri Chinchwad Municipal Corporation or Pune Municipal Corporation (PMC) are responsible for evaluating a property. They assess and give value to the property by levying taxes on it. PMC has been in charge of serving its citizen since 1950. With that, in Pune, property tax is the second largest revenue earned after Octroi.
There was a new introduction for automating the entire process and safeguarding the property tax.
To boost revenue, PMC September 2016 initiated geotagging properties. These were conducted in their jurisdiction while finding unauthorised and illegal properties through GIS. This practice includes verification of the property, mentioning the owner's name, clicking the property picture, and documentation.
The geotagging of properties in Pune has led to a significant increase in the revenue for PMC. Through this, they can identify defaulters easily.
Property tax is necessary for all properties, including vacant lands within Municipal corporation limits.
Property tax is calculated on the carpet area of the building/property. In Pune, the calculation for the same is based on The Capital value-based system for property tax calculation.
There are some sorts of properties that don't require the homeowner to pay property taxes. Yes, there are exceptions that you don't have to pay any property tax, which is applicable in exceptional cases.
With that, some individuals are allowed concessions when they pay their property tax. For example, if the property is used for public or religious worship, you don't have to pay tax. Moreover, if your property is registered for a charitable institute/trust by the charity commissioner, you can avoid paying taxes.
There are a few exceptions when talking about concession on paying property taxes. According to PMC, you get a 50% concession to those specialised individuals. It can be ex-servicemen/freedom fighters/their wives.
Also, individuals can get a 40% rebate if the property is owned and registered under the name of a disabled person. The disability, however, has to be above 40%.
Before proceeding with how to pay property tax online in Pune? Let us find out how it is calculated. Property tax is the portion of the property's actual value based on the ready reckoner and utilised by the revenue department to determine stamp duty.
Property tax = Tax Rate x Capital Value
Capital Value = Base Value x Built up area x Usage x Building type x Age factor x Floor factor

The last date is usually May 31 to make your first half-year property tax payment, and the months are usually (April to September).
The second half (October to December) must be paid in full by December 31. Thus it helps you in avoiding all sorts of penalties.
If you cannot pay your property tax on time, a penalty of 2% is imposed monthly. It will start on July 1 for the first half-year and on January 1 for the second half-year.
In addition, tax refunds are available for those who pay their taxes on or before the dedicated timeline.
Real estate owners, be it a residential or commercial establishment, are eligible for a 10% discount on annual values up to Rs25000. Owners also receive a 5% discount if the annual value exceeds Rs25000.
